/*
To change this license header, choose License Headers in Project Properties.
To change this template file, choose Tools | Templates
and open the template in the editor.
*/
/* 
    Created on : Feb 13, 2018, 6:59:07 PM
    Author     : zarkov
*/
.content-main {
  /*float: right;*/
  width: 100%; }

nav.side__menu.sidebar-menu.sidebar-menu {
  width: 262px;
  background-color: #fbfbfa;
  border-right: 1px solid rgba(0, 0, 0, 0.1);
  box-shadow: none; }
  nav.side__menu.sidebar-menu.sidebar-menu::-webkit-scrollbar {
    width: 4px; }
  nav.side__menu.sidebar-menu.sidebar-menu::-webkit-scrollbar-track {
    -webkit-box-shadow: inset 0 0 6px rgba(0, 0, 0, 0.3); }
  nav.side__menu.sidebar-menu.sidebar-menu::-webkit-scrollbar-thumb {
    background-color: #55505a; }
  nav.side__menu.sidebar-menu.sidebar-menu ul {
    padding: 24px 0 0 0; }
    nav.side__menu.sidebar-menu.sidebar-menu ul li {
      list-style: none;
      color: #55595a;
      font-size: 16px; }
      nav.side__menu.sidebar-menu.sidebar-menu ul li a {
        color: #55505a;
        font-weight: normal;
        padding: 0 16px 0 86px;
        font-size: 16px;
        line-height: 48px; }
        nav.side__menu.sidebar-menu.sidebar-menu ul li a:before {
          left: 46px; }
    nav.side__menu.sidebar-menu.sidebar-menu ul .active {
      color: #55595a; }
    nav.side__menu.sidebar-menu.sidebar-menu ul a.dropdown {
      border: solid rgba(0, 0, 0, 0.1);
      border-width: 1px 0;
      padding: 24px 32px 24px 40px;
      transition: .3s; }
      nav.side__menu.sidebar-menu.sidebar-menu ul a.dropdown .icon {
        float: right;
        line-height: 24px;
        font-size: 12px;
        height: 24px;
        width: 24px;
        text-align: center;
        border-radius: 50%;
        margin-top: 12px;
        background-repeat: no-repeat;
        background-position: center;
        background-size: 16px; }
      nav.side__menu.sidebar-menu.sidebar-menu ul a.dropdown .icon-minus {
        display: none;
        background-color: #fad705;
        background-image: url("../images/symbols/icon-minus.svg"); }
      nav.side__menu.sidebar-menu.sidebar-menu ul a.dropdown .icon-plus {
        display: block;
        background-image: url("../images/symbols/icon-plus.svg"); }
      nav.side__menu.sidebar-menu.sidebar-menu ul a.dropdown .icon-gear {
        display: block;
        background-image: url("../images/symbols/icon-gear.svg"); }
    nav.side__menu.sidebar-menu.sidebar-menu ul .opened:before {
      background: none; }
    nav.side__menu.sidebar-menu.sidebar-menu ul .opened a.dropdown {
      background: #ffffff;
      border-bottom: none;
      padding-bottom: 0px;
      transition: .3s; }
      nav.side__menu.sidebar-menu.sidebar-menu ul .opened a.dropdown .icon-minus {
        display: block; }
      nav.side__menu.sidebar-menu.sidebar-menu ul .opened a.dropdown .icon-plus {
        display: none; }
    nav.side__menu.sidebar-menu.sidebar-menu ul .sub {
      background: #ffffff;
      padding: 0; }
      nav.side__menu.sidebar-menu.sidebar-menu ul .sub li a {
        padding: 9px 16px 9px 40px;
        line-height: normal; }
        nav.side__menu.sidebar-menu.sidebar-menu ul .sub li a h6 {
          font-size: 12px;
          line-height: 1.33;
          margin: 0;
          color: #55505a; }
        nav.side__menu.sidebar-menu.sidebar-menu ul .sub li a h5 {
          line-height: 2;
          margin: 0;
          text-decoration: underline; }
        nav.side__menu.sidebar-menu.sidebar-menu ul .sub li a:hover h5 {
          text-decoration: none; }
        nav.side__menu.sidebar-menu.sidebar-menu ul .sub li a img {
          width: 24px;
          float: left;
          margin: 8px 16px;
          border-radius: 50%; }
      nav.side__menu.sidebar-menu.sidebar-menu ul .sub li .category {
        padding-left: 86px;
        padding-right: 16px; }
        nav.side__menu.sidebar-menu.sidebar-menu ul .sub li .category:before {
          width: 24px;
          height: 24px;
          top: 16px; }

nav.side__menu.sidebar-menu .nav__link-icon.home:before {
  background-image: url("../images/symbols/home-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.home: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.home:before {
  background-image: url("../images/symbols/home.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.purchases:before {
  background-image: url("../images/symbols/icon-purchases-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.purchases: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.purchases:before {
  background-image: url("../images/symbols/icon-purchases.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.cart:before {
  background-image: url("../images/symbols/icon-cart-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.cart: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.cart:before {
  background-image: url("../images/symbols/icon-cart.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.upload:before {
  background-image: url("../images/symbols/icon-upload.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.upload: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.upload:before {
  background-image: url("../images/symbols/icon-upload-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.favourites:before {
  background-image: url("../images/symbols/icon-favorites-grey.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.favourites: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.favourites:before {
  background-image: url("../images/symbols/icon-favorites-slate_grey.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.trending:before {
  background-image: url("../images/symbols/trending-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.trending: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.trending:before {
  background-image: url("../images/symbols/trending.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.assignments:before {
  background-image: url("../images/symbols/videobriefs-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.assignments: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.assignments:before {
  background-image: url("../images/symbols/videobriefs.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.icon-watch:before {
  background-image: url("../images/symbols/icon-clock-slate_grey-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.icon-watch: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.icon-watch:before {
  background-image: url("../images/symbols/icon-clock-slate_grey.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.profile:before {
  background-image: url("../images/symbols/profile-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.profile: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.profile:before {
  background-image: url("../images/symbols/profile.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.categories:before {
  background-image: url("../images/symbols/categories-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.categories: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.categories:before {
  background-image: url("../images/symbols/categories.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.recommended:before {
  background-image: url("../images/symbols/recommended-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.recommended: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.recommended:before {
  background-image: url("../images/symbols/recommended.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.referrals:before {
  background-image: url("../images/symbols/icon-refer_member-grey.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.referrals: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.referrals:before {
  background-image: url("../images/symbols/icon-refer_member-slate_grey.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.earnings:before {
  background-image: url("../images/symbols/earnings-hover.svg"); }

nav.side__menu.sidebar-menu .nav__link-icon.earnings:hover:before,
nav.side__menu.sidebar-menu .active .nav__link-icon.earnings:before {
  background-image: url("../images/symbols/earnings.svg"); }

.js-humb-menu.menu__icon {
  padding: 7px 7px 10px 7px;
  border-radius: 50%; }

.js-humb-menu.menu__icon.active {
  background: #fad705; }

.gut-l40 {
  padding-left: 40px !important; }

/*header*/
.header__wrap #quick-search {
  max-width: 100%; }
  .header__wrap #quick-search .form__field-wrap input[type="search"] {
    height: 40px; }

.header__wrap .btn-flat__wrap a,
.header__wrap:after,
header .menu__icon-wrap:after {
  background: transparent; }

header .header__wrap {
  padding: 0 30px; }
  header .header__wrap .logo-area {
    min-width: 145px;
    padding: 0 0 0 8px; }
    header .header__wrap .logo-area .logo {
      height: 24px; }
  header .header__wrap .btn-flat__wrap a span {
    width: 40px;
    height: 40px; }

header header {
  border-bottom: 1px solid rgba(0, 0, 0, 0.1);
  box-shadow: 0px 2px 3px rgba(0, 0, 0, 0.1); }

@media (max-width: 767px) {
  nav.side__menu.sidebar-menu.sidebar-menu {
    position: fixed;
    width: 100%; }
  .content-main {
    width: 100% !important; }
  header .header__wrap {
    padding: 0 8px !important; }
    header .header__wrap .logo-area.buyer {
      width: calc(100% - 45px); }
    header .header__wrap .logo-area {
      min-width: auto !important;
      width: calc(100% - 72px);
      padding-left: 22px; }
      header .header__wrap .logo-area .logo {
        width: 24px;
        background-size: cover;
        margin: 0 auto; }
    header .header__wrap .header__menu-mobile {
      position: absolute;
      width: auto;
      z-index: 10000;
      float: right; }
      header .header__wrap .header__menu-mobile .read img {
        width: 30px;
        height: 30px;
        border-radius: 50%; }
      header .header__wrap .header__menu-mobile .nf_iconset.search {
        font-size: 21px !important; }
    header .header__wrap .header__mobile-search {
      left: 0 !important;
      z-index: 10001; }
      header .header__wrap .header__mobile-search form {
        width: 100% !important; }
  header .form__field-wrap input[type="search"] {
    min-width: 100%;
    background: white;
    margin: 0;
    padding-right: 0; }
  .header__menu-mobile a {
    margin-left: 5px; } }

@media (max-width: 992px) {
  header .header__wrap {
    padding: 0 6px; } }

nav.side__menu.sidebar-menu.sidebar-menu .nf-logged-out-menu li {
  padding: 0 16px; }
  nav.side__menu.sidebar-menu.sidebar-menu .nf-logged-out-menu li .mb-16 {
    margin-bottom: 16px; }
  nav.side__menu.sidebar-menu.sidebar-menu .nf-logged-out-menu li a {
    padding: 0; }
  nav.side__menu.sidebar-menu.sidebar-menu .nf-logged-out-menu li a.btn.btn-default {
    line-height: 32px;
    color: #ffffff; }
  nav.side__menu.sidebar-menu.sidebar-menu .nf-logged-out-menu li:hover a.btn.btn-default {
    background-color: #55505a; }
